Thursday, February 24, 2011

Adjustable splitter

Here's something thats been in my mind, feel free to comment.


I want to run the car low, but that means avoiding my driveway with any kind of splitter.


Ive been thinking of ways to have an extendable section or simply one that slides in when I need it for circuit days.. Held in by pins or bolts.

The one that slides in is easy. Just affix some bars along the underside and slide the front section into some tubes. These are running strainght along the body, so it wouldn't detract from the effect much? would it?


This car has an outer edge only, the centre could be added for track days.


I actually want it a bit lower like this picture.


R- Magic make one also but it's crazy expensive and probably wouldn't match the body of my car.

What to do?

Saturday, November 20, 2010

SAB Reflections


OK, so my first highway drive out to SAB in chiba. I can't believe I've had the car for over a month and I've hardly done 100klms. Well actually I can believe it. Many small issues and other shit going on.

I would like a circuit or mountain attack to test my fun factor, highway drive is about as boring for me as watching paint dry. But the car seems to behave itself in it's high state of tune on the trip.

The suspension is pretty hard, and any serious japanese highway corrigation isn't absorbed so well but that is to be expected, general handling however is very good. the few corners on the way provided surefooted direction change.

See if I can find some time before or after my Tsukuba trip. Parked next to this R-Magic demo car. the stance is way too high. I need it about 20~25mm down to be happy.

Monday, July 12, 2010

Combat 7:13 Inspiration @ 7's Day

I am really loving the Veilside Evolution Combat C3 kit. I met the owner at 7's day and had a good look at the fender kit.

The rear provides a boatload of space with the guards trimmed and welded underneath. The fronts can also house some fatness. Gun Advan RS 18x9 +20ish looks easy

The owner has keps the 20 spoke Veilside rims which he agreed were painful to clean and admitted he did a poor job of cleaning them. They did however have a huge dish in the rear (he couldn't remember offsets though)

He also had a fortune FD rear window in White that while it looked great from the rear, it didn't show the car's lines well in profile. This is not on my agenda.
